Director, FP&A – Commercial Finance

Remote · USA Full-time New today

Job Description:

  • Lead, mentor and develop a high performing team of finance professionals (team of 5)
  • Own Actuals, Budget, and Forecast for all topline metrics (Revenue, Bookings, ARR, Billings, etc.) and support the Sales & Marketing organization.
  • Lead annual planning, monthly and quarterly forecasting, management reporting, and business analytics for areas of responsibility.
  • Oversee commission administration and forecasting, and partner with Revenue Operations on commission plan design and quota setting.
  • Leverage the FP&A software (Pigment), Salesforce, and NetSuite data to translate business performance into clear, actionable insights. Build and maintain monthly and quarterly financial reporting packages highlighting trends and performance across Sales & Marketing.
  • Deliver detailed variance analysis and commentary across key topline drivers, including bookings, churn, revenue, backlog, and ARR.
  • Prepare business cases to support new investments and/or strategic initiatives.
  • Act as a key advisor to Sales and Operations leaders on commercial terms and business decisions.
  • Design and implement scalable processes to improve efficiency, accuracy, and business outcomes.
  • Present financial results and plans to senior leadership and c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Drive continuous improvement to produce innovation in reporting, planning and analysis.
  • Additional ad hoc duties as required.

Requirements:

  • 10+ years of progressive finance and leadership experience within B2B technology/software companies, ideally with recurring revenue models and Private Equity (PE) ownership
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with attention to detail and the ability to synthesize insights into a clear, strategic narrative. Proven ability to assess risks and opportunities within financial projections.
  • Strong business acumen, including a solid understanding of sales strategy and operations.
  • Demonstrated ability to drive process improvements and scale finance capabilities within a growing organization.
  • Deep expertise in topline KPIs, including ARR and related SaaS metrics.
  • Proven track record designing and managing complex commission plans in B2B tech environments.
  • Ability to influence and build strong relationships across all levels of the organization.
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ance or Business Administration required, MBA or equivalent preferred
  • Experience in US GAAP / ASC606 revenue recognition is an asset.
  • Proven ability to build and lead high-performing, engaged teams.
  • Strong technical and financial modeling capabilities.
  • Experience with Pigment or similar FP&A tools (e.g. Adaptive), Salesforce required.
